Finland vs Norway: Electricity Compared
Finland generated 82.3 TWh of electricity in 2025 and Norway 161 TWh, according to Ember. Finland's largest source was nuclear (39.8%); Norway's was hydro (90.0%). Each kWh generated emitted 57 gCO2/kWh in Finland and 28 gCO2/kWh in Norway. These are Ember annual statistics for 2025, compiled from national sources; they are not real time.
Why this comparison: neighbours by land border or interconnector.
Key Facts
- Hydro supplied 90.0% of Norway's electricity in 2025, against 15.1% in Finland.
- Finland's electricity was 2.0 times as carbon intensive as Norway's in 2025, at 57 gCO2/kWh against 28 gCO2/kWh.
- Low carbon sources supplied 96.4% of Finland's electricity in 2025 and 99.0% of Norway's.
- Electricity demand in 2025 was 87.9 TWh in Finland and 138 TWh in Norway.
Key Figures, 2025
Ember annual statistics| Measure | Finland | Norway |
|---|---|---|
| Total generation | 82.3 TWh | 161 TWh |
| Electricity demand | 87.9 TWh | 138 TWh |
| Demand per person | 15.62 MWh | 24.50 MWh |
| Carbon intensity | 57 gCO2/kWh | 28 gCO2/kWh |
| Power sector emissions | 4.71 MtCO2 | 4.51 MtCO2 |
| Low carbon share | 96.4% | 99.0% |
| Largest source | Nuclear 39.8% | Hydro 90.0% |
Generation Mix, 2025
Share of generation| Source | Finland | Norway |
|---|---|---|
| Hydro | 15.1% | 90.0% |
| Nuclear | 39.8% | 0.0% |
| Wind | 27.5% | 8.4% |
| Bioenergy | 12.6% | 0.2% |
| Other fossil | 2.3% | 0.4% |
| Solar | 1.2% | 0.3% |
| Gas | 1.1% | 0.6% |
| Coal | 0.2% | 0.0% |
| Other renewables | 0.2% | 0.1% |
Carbon Intensity, 1990 to 2025
Ember annual statisticsAnnual statistics through 2025, gCO2/kWh
| Year | Finland | Norway |
|---|---|---|
| 1990 | 282 gCO2/kWh | 25 gCO2/kWh |
| 1991 | 276 gCO2/kWh | 26 gCO2/kWh |
| 1992 | 245 gCO2/kWh | 25 gCO2/kWh |
| 1993 | 278 gCO2/kWh | 26 gCO2/kWh |
| 1994 | 337 gCO2/kWh | 26 gCO2/kWh |
| 1995 | 304 gCO2/kWh | 26 gCO2/kWh |
| 1996 | 351 gCO2/kWh | 27 gCO2/kWh |
| 1997 | 319 gCO2/kWh | 27 gCO2/kWh |
| 1998 | 250 gCO2/kWh | 26 gCO2/kWh |
| 1999 | 263 gCO2/kWh | 27 gCO2/kWh |
| 2000 | 247 gCO2/kWh | 26 gCO2/kWh |
| 2001 | 285 gCO2/kWh | 27 gCO2/kWh |
| 2002 | 316 gCO2/kWh | 27 gCO2/kWh |
| 2003 | 371 gCO2/kWh | 28 gCO2/kWh |
| 2004 | 325 gCO2/kWh | 28 gCO2/kWh |
| 2005 | 231 gCO2/kWh | 27 gCO2/kWh |
| 2006 | 336 gCO2/kWh | 28 gCO2/kWh |
| 2007 | 309 gCO2/kWh | 29 gCO2/kWh |
| 2008 | 246 gCO2/kWh | 27 gCO2/kWh |
| 2009 | 276 gCO2/kWh | 39 gCO2/kWh |
| 2010 | 315 gCO2/kWh | 43 gCO2/kWh |
| 2011 | 268 gCO2/kWh | 38 gCO2/kWh |
| 2012 | 215 gCO2/kWh | 32 gCO2/kWh |
| 2013 | 257 gCO2/kWh | 34 gCO2/kWh |
| 2014 | 227 gCO2/kWh | 34 gCO2/kWh |
| 2015 | 182 gCO2/kWh | 34 gCO2/kWh |
| 2016 | 200 gCO2/kWh | 33 gCO2/kWh |
| 2017 | 186 gCO2/kWh | 33 gCO2/kWh |
| 2018 | 194 gCO2/kWh | 33 gCO2/kWh |
| 2019 | 171 gCO2/kWh | 33 gCO2/kWh |
| 2020 | 130 gCO2/kWh | 30 gCO2/kWh |
| 2021 | 136 gCO2/kWh | 27 gCO2/kWh |
| 2022 | 130 gCO2/kWh | 30 gCO2/kWh |
| 2023 | 81 gCO2/kWh | 30 gCO2/kWh |
| 2024 | 67 gCO2/kWh | 30 gCO2/kWh |
| 2025 | 57 gCO2/kWh | 28 gCO2/kWh |
Demand per Person, 1990 to 2025
Ember annual statisticsAnnual statistics through 2025, MWh
| Year | Finland | Norway |
|---|---|---|

| 2000 | 15.81 MWh | 27.49 MWh |
| 2001 | 16.27 MWh | 27.67 MWh |
| 2002 | 16.70 MWh | 26.56 MWh |
| 2003 | 17.10 MWh | 25.09 MWh |
| 2004 | 17.35 MWh | 26.47 MWh |
| 2005 | 16.69 MWh | 27.08 MWh |
| 2006 | 17.79 MWh | 26.19 MWh |
| 2007 | 17.72 MWh | 26.77 MWh |
| 2008 | 16.96 MWh | 26.71 MWh |
| 2009 | 15.76 MWh | 25.26 MWh |
| 2010 | 16.99 MWh | 26.73 MWh |
| 2011 | 16.21 MWh | 24.80 MWh |
| 2012 | 16.23 MWh | 25.58 MWh |
| 2013 | 15.99 MWh | 25.22 MWh |
| 2014 | 15.76 MWh | 24.39 MWh |
| 2015 | 15.50 MWh | 24.73 MWh |
| 2016 | 15.96 MWh | 25.14 MWh |
| 2017 | 15.97 MWh | 25.23 MWh |
| 2018 | 16.35 MWh | 25.56 MWh |
| 2019 | 16.06 MWh | 25.03 MWh |
| 2020 | 15.25 MWh | 24.88 MWh |
| 2021 | 16.22 MWh | 25.80 MWh |
| 2022 | 15.21 MWh | 24.36 MWh |
| 2023 | 14.86 MWh | 24.62 MWh |
| 2024 | 15.26 MWh | 24.87 MWh |
| 2025 | 15.62 MWh | 24.50 MWh |
